State Songs of New Hampshire:

1949

  

Old New Hampshire
by Dr. John F. Holmes and music by Maurice Hoffmann

1963

New Hampshire, My New Hampshire
by Julius Richelson and Walter P. Smith

1973

New Hampshire Hills
by Paul Scott Maurer and Tom Powers

1977

Autumn in New Hampshire
by Leo Austin

1977

New Hampshire's Granite State
by Anne B. Currier

1977

Oh, New Hampshire (you're my home)
by Brownie McIntosh

1977

The Old Man of the Mountain
by Paul Belanger

1977

The New Hampshire State March
by Rene Richards

1983

New Hampshire Naturally
by Rick Shaw and Ron Shaw

2007

Live Free or Die
by Barry Palmer
